John Neece graduated from Texas A&M with a doctorate in Counseling Psychology in 1993. He has worked for the Utah State University Center for Persons with Disabilities as a psychologist in their clinical services program. He later was a trial consultant for Trial Behavioral Consulting in Dallas. He joined River Valley Health, formerly Cherokee Health Systems, in 2002 and has been working as a psychologist with River Valley Health since that time. John sees child, adolescent and adult patients. He also enjoys training doctoral students from the University of Tennessee who are performing practicums with River Valley Health.
